黑狐家游戏

数据仓库与数据库的主要区别是什么?,数据仓库与数据库,深入解析两者间的核心差异

欧气 1 0

本文目录导读:

  1. 功能与目的
  2. 应用场景
  3. 设计理念

在当今信息化时代,数据仓库和数据库已成为企业信息化建设的重要基石,两者在功能、应用场景、设计理念等方面存在显著差异,本文将从多个角度深入解析数据仓库与数据库的主要区别,帮助读者更好地理解这两者的应用场景。

功能与目的

1、数据库

数据仓库与数据库的主要区别是什么?,数据仓库与数据库,深入解析两者间的核心差异

图片来源于网络,如有侵权联系删除

数据库的主要功能是存储、管理和检索数据,它为用户提供了一个稳定、高效的数据存储平台,使得数据得以持久化存储,便于后续的数据分析和处理,数据库广泛应用于各类业务系统,如ERP、CRM等。

2、数据仓库

数据仓库的核心功能是支持数据分析和决策制定,它通过对企业内部和外部数据的整合、清洗、转换和聚合,为用户提供了一个全面、一致、历史性的数据视图,数据仓库主要服务于数据分析和数据挖掘,为企业的战略决策提供支持。

应用场景

1、数据库

数据库适用于以下场景:

(1)存储和管理业务数据:如客户信息、订单信息、库存信息等。

(2)支持事务处理:如银行、证券、电商等行业的实时交易处理。

数据仓库与数据库的主要区别是什么?,数据仓库与数据库,深入解析两者间的核心差异

图片来源于网络,如有侵权联系删除

(3)保证数据一致性:通过事务管理,确保数据的一致性和完整性。

2、数据仓库

数据仓库适用于以下场景:

(1)数据分析和挖掘:如市场分析、客户细分、销售预测等。

(2)战略决策支持:为企业提供历史数据、趋势分析和预测,支持战略决策。

(3)数据挖掘和知识发现:通过挖掘数据中的隐藏模式,为企业提供有价值的信息。

设计理念

1、数据库

数据仓库与数据库的主要区别是什么?,数据仓库与数据库,深入解析两者间的核心差异

图片来源于网络,如有侵权联系删除

数据库的设计理念主要关注数据的一致性、完整性和安全性,数据库采用ACID(原子性、一致性、隔离性、持久性)原则,确保数据在存储、处理和传输过程中的稳定性。

2、数据仓库

数据仓库的设计理念主要关注数据的集成、历史性和面向主题,数据仓库采用OLAP(在线分析处理)技术,通过多维数据模型和聚合计算,为用户提供高效的数据分析和挖掘能力。

数据仓库与数据库在功能、应用场景、设计理念等方面存在显著差异,数据库主要关注数据的存储、管理和检索,适用于业务系统和事务处理;而数据仓库主要关注数据分析和决策制定,适用于数据分析和战略决策,了解这两者的区别,有助于企业在信息化建设中更好地选择和应用相关技术。

标签: #数据仓库与数据库的主要区别是

黑狐家游戏
  • 评论列表

留言评论